15 Jan 2008 | Abstract: | We present GALEX near-UV (NUV) and 2MASS J band photometry for red sequence
galaxies in local clusters. We define quiescent samples according to a strict
emission threshold, removing galaxies with very recent star formation. We
analyse the NUV-J colour-magnitude relation (CMR) and find that the intrinsic
scatter is an order of magnitude larger than for the analogous optical CMR
(~0.35 rather than 0.05 mag), in agreement with previous studies. Comparing the
NUV-J colours with spectroscopically-derived stellar population parameters, we
find a strong (> 5.5sigma) correlation with metallicity, only a marginal trend
with age, and no correlation with the alpha/Fe ratio. We explore the origin of
the large scatter and conclude that neither aperture effects nor the UV upturn
phenomenon contribute significantly. We show that the scatter could be
attributed to simple ’frosting’ by either a young or a low metallicity
subpopulation. | Source: | arXiv, 0801.2390 | Services: | Forum | Review | PDF | Favorites |
